TORONTO, Sept. 29,
2022 /CNW/ - Laurion Mineral Exploration
Inc. (TSXV: LME) (OTCPINK: LMEFF) ("LAURION" or the
"Corporation") is pleased to announce the voting results
of the Annual and Special Meeting of Shareholders of the
Corporation that was held on September 28,
2022 (the "Meeting").
Election of Directors
Each of the nominees for election as directors listed in the
Corporation's management information circular dated
August 19, 2022 (the
"Circular") were elected as directors of the
Corporation for the ensuing year or until their successors are
elected or appointed.
Other Items of Business Considered
at the Meeting
Each of the following resolutions voted on at the Meeting were
also passed:
- The reappointment of RSM LLP as auditors of the Corporation for
the ensuing year and the authorization of the directors of the
Corporation to fix their remuneration and the terms of their
engagement.
- A resolution ratifying, confirming and approving the renewal of
the Corporation's rolling stock option plan (the "SOP"), as
such plan and such resolution are set forth in the Circular.
Specifically, disinterested shareholders approved certain
amendments to the SOP, which was updated to be in compliance with
TSX Venture Exchange Policy 4.4 – Security Based
Compensation. The SOP is a "rolling" plan pursuant to which the
aggregate number of shares to be issued under the SOP shall not
exceed 10% of the Corporation's issued and outstanding shares. For
further information with respect to the amendments to the SOP,
please see the Circular. The SOP remains subject to final TSX
Venture Exchange approval.

About LAURION
The Corporation is a junior mineral exploration and development
company listed on the TSXV under the symbol LME and on the OTCPINK
under the symbol LMEFF. LAURION now has 255,969,855 outstanding
shares of which approximately 80% are owned and controlled by
Insiders who are eligible investors under the "Friends and Family"
categories.
LAURION's emphasis is on the development of its flagship
project, the 100% owned mid-stage 47 km2 Ishkoday
Project, and its gold-silver and gold-rich polymetallic
mineralization with a significant upside potential. The
mineralization on Ishkoday is open at depth beyond the current
core-drilling limit of -200 m from
surface, based on the historical mining to a -685 m depth, in the past producing Sturgeon
River Mine. The Brenbar Property, which was acquired in 2020 and is
contiguous with the Ishkoday Property, hosts the historic Brenbar
Mine. LAURION believes the mineralization to be a direct extension
of mineralization from the Ishkoday Property.
